Lacunose is a research gap-finding engine powered by Claude Opus 4.7. Researchers waste months reading hundreds of papers just to find a handful of novel gaps worth pursuing. Lacunose queries 7 scientific databases in parallel, then runs a 7-stage agentic pipeline (~60 Claude calls: MAP → cluster → REDUCE → CRITIQUE → rank) to surface ~10 ranked, citation-grounded research gaps in 2–4 minutes. Each gap includes a research question, suggested study design, novelty/feasibility scores, and verbatim evidence quotes from real papers, output quality close to a half-written grant abstract.
